Default To Those who have seen the Z in person

I was looking at some of the amazing pictures you have taken while the tour was in texas and I had a question about the Sill Kick Plates. It appears the show cars have black sill kick plates with an silver Z in the middle. These looked great. But, I know you can accessorize with aluminum inserts. Does the standard one look good or should I get the aluminum inserts down the road?

Thanks for any info you may have.

Buy the aluminum!!!

Those silver "Z" on the black one is just some kind of overlay and would get messed up really easy. The pre-production one's were already messed up!!!

The black one's are seriously nasty. I forgot to mention those in RAI's "Interior Quality" thread the other day. If you haven't sat in the Z, you get down in really low and have to crawl out. The black sills in that Daytona 5AT were beat to death and definitely the cheapest plastic in the interior bar none.

I ordered the aluminum kick plates without a second thought and I'm very glad I did so.
